When to use shot glass in Korean
Korean: 술잔[ sul-jan ]

When to use it
A shot glass (술잔) is a very small glass used for strong drinks like soju. People use this word when talking about drinking at home, in a restaurant, or buying small drink cups. It usually means a small glass for alcohol, not a regular water cup.
Example sentences
집에서 작은 술잔을 씻었어요.
I washed the small shot glass at home.
식당에서 술잔 두 개를 달라고 했어요.
I asked for two shot glasses at the restaurant.
친구가 술잔에 소주를 조금 따랐어요.
My friend poured a little soju into the shot glass.
여행 기념으로 나무 술잔을 샀어요.
I bought a wooden shot glass as a travel souvenir.
캠핑장에서 술잔이 테이블에서 떨어졌어요.
The shot glass fell from the table at the campsite.
미술 시간에 술잔 그림을 그렸어요.
I drew a picture of a shot glass in art class.
